To connect a social account, go to the Connect Account page in your dashboard and click Add on the platform you want to connect.
Platform-specific instructions
Instagram — You need an Instagram Business or Creator account linked to a Facebook Page. Personal accounts are not supported. During authorization, make sure to grant all requested permissions including posting and analytics access.
Facebook — Only Facebook Pages can be connected, not personal profiles. You'll select which Pages to authorize during the OAuth flow. Make sure you're an admin of the Page.
TikTok — You'll be redirected to TikTok to authorize solnk. Your TikTok account must be a Business or Creator account to publish via the API.
YouTube — Sign in with your Google account and select the YouTube channel you want to connect. You must have a YouTube channel created before connecting.
LinkedIn — Both personal profiles and Company Pages are supported. For Company Pages, you need admin access to the page.
Pinterest — You'll authorize solnk to access your boards. After connecting, you can select which board to pin to when creating a post.
X / Twitter — Sign in with your X account to authorize solnk. Token expiration is common on X — use the Refresh button on the Connect Account page if your account disconnects.
Threads — Connects through your Instagram account. You need an Instagram Business or Creator account with Threads enabled.
Bluesky — Enter your handle (e.g., yourname.bsky.social) and an App Password — not your regular login password. To create an App Password, go to Bluesky Settings > App Passwords > Add App Password.
After connecting
- A green checkmark appears next to successfully connected accounts
- You can test the connection by creating a quick post
- If an account shows a warning icon, try disconnecting and reconnecting it
Common issues
- "Permission denied" error — Make sure you granted all requested permissions during authorization. Try disconnecting and reconnecting.
- Account not appearing after auth — Check that your account meets the platform's requirements (Business account for Instagram, admin access for Facebook Pages, etc.)
- Token expired — Click the Refresh button on the Connect Account page to re-authorize all accounts at once.